Reflections upon the Education of Children in Charity Schools
Discover the insightful work of Sarah Trimmer in Reflections upon the Education of Children in Charity Schools, published by Cambridge University Press in 2010. This engaging paperback spans 62 pages and serves as a valuable resource for those interested in the evolution of education in the 18th century. Trimmer provides practical advice on organizing charity schools, emphasizing the importance of a new, age-appropriate curriculum designed to enhance children's understanding of essential concepts. This book not only reflects on educational practices of the time but also sheds light on the social dynamics surrounding charity schooling.
